▸Does Lemon Neural let you follow specific people with AI?
No. An advanced artificial intelligence system like Lemon Neural could in theory track individuals, but doing so would raise serious privacy concerns and would not comply with rules like the RGPD (the EU General Data Protection Regulation).
So Lemon Neural is built with privacy as its founding principle and top priority:
· It does not allow individual tracking of people: our computer vision technology is configured to process information in a way that never identifies a particular individual and never stores recognisable personal data.
· It works on aggregate patterns: instead, Lemon Neural analyses how groups move and produces aggregate statistics on the general flow and the collective behaviour of the public. It looks at trends and at figures for the space as a whole.
· Anonymisation guaranteed: the analysis is done on data that has already been anonymised in real time (identifiable elements are pixelated or blurred).
That keeps individuals completely anonymous while still giving you information worth having for improving your spaces and your operations, always in strict compliance with data protection and privacy law.
▸Can Lemon Neural detect someone coming in through the exit?
Yes. Lemon Neural can detect accurately, and alert you immediately, if someone uses an exit point as a way into your premises.
Lemon Neural's artificial intelligence and computer vision make this possible by analysing movement patterns and the direction of flow at each access point. When it detects abnormal movement — someone coming in at a point meant only for going out — the system can:
· Raise real-time alerts: notify your security or management staff instantly.
· Help with security: help prevent unauthorised access or people getting round security controls.
· Keep the flow of people orderly: help maintain the direction of movement, avoiding congestion and the risk or confusion that can come with it, especially at busy times.
Watching access and reverse flow this way is useful for keeping your premises secure, running efficiently and giving your customers a smooth experience.

▸How do I know whether my window display is working?
Your window is your business's first impression: it can attract people, invite them in… or go unnoticed. But how do you know whether it is actually working? Being attractive is not enough; it has to catch the eye, create interest and, in the end, bring in visits and sales.
Measuring that used to be hard. Today you can do it objectively.
Lemon Neural detects how many people stop in front of your window, how long they stay looking and whether they then come into the shop. With those figures you can judge what the design really does, see which elements work best and adjust your visual campaigns to convert more people from outside.
